If you did you would need to change the pistons to forged as well.. the flat head is a low rpm engine for a few reasons, the stroke is 4 & 5/8 inches!! The crank shaft can handle it it is forged and very very strong but it is very heavy, one guy can barely install a 230 crank alone. the combustion chanmber designs inherently makes it so cannot handle the high compression ratios of a higher revvinng OHV engine. the rods on a 230 are offset to make the engine shorter and can bend at high RPMS or an old racer told me her used to rip the pistons in half at the drag strip if he over revved his 230. I think you could do turbo but do it like you mentioned and desing it to work at low RPMs.
